2-Linux驱动和内核模块编程.ppt
上传人:qw****27 上传时间:2024-09-12 格式:PPT 页数:39 大小:5.2MB 金币:15 举报 版权申诉
预览加载中,请您耐心等待几秒...

2-Linux驱动和内核模块编程.ppt

2-Linux驱动和内核模块编程.ppt

预览

免费试读已结束,剩余 29 页请下载文档后查看

15 金币

下载此文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

Linux驱动程序概述本章目标本章内容为什么要学习嵌入式Linux驱动程序开发?设备驱动程序简介设备的分类和特点设备的分类和特点1-2设备的分类和特点1-2设备的分类和特点块设备网络设备网络设备驱动程序构造和运行模块1-3驱动程序加入内核的方法内核模块的定义内核模块与应用程序对比内核模块是如何被调用的内核模块必须的函数动手写一个内核模块设备驱动的HelloWorld模块设备驱动的HelloWorld模块编译和装载驱动模块MakefileMakefile装载驱动模块卸载驱动模块内核打印函数运行内核模块设备驱动的HelloWorld模块(hello.c)内核模块参数内核模块参数导出符号模块计数补充信息带参数的helloworld内核模块程序阶段总结本章总结总结作业